This amount of exercise is best for the brain.

Báo Thanh niênBáo Thanh niên04/11/2024


New research, just published in the journal Communications Psychology , has found the best amount of exercise for the brain,

Accordingly, short bursts of activity can significantly increase brain power, according to science news site Scitech Daily.

Cycling and high-intensity interval training (HIIT) have big effects on the brain

Scientists at the University of California Santa Barbara (USA) studied 113 previous studies, with the participation of a total of 4,390 people, aged 18 to 45.

The results found that short bursts of vigorous activity were best for cognition. In particular, cycling and high-intensity interval training (HIIT) had the greatest effect on the brain's executive function, significantly improving memory and attention.

Vigorous activities have the greatest impact on the brain, said lead author Dr. Barry Giesbrecht, a professor in the Department of Psychological and Brain Sciences at the University of California Santa Barbara.

Short bouts of exercise have positive effects on the brain, with the strongest effects seen after exercise of less than 30 minutes.

Notably, short bouts of exercise had a positive impact on cognition, with the strongest effect seen after exercise lasting less than 30 minutes. The results showed that the impact of exercise lasting less than 30 minutes was greater than exercise lasting more than 30 minutes, according to Scitech Daily.

The good news is that you don't need to do a lot of exercise to reap the benefits - sometimes just 10 minutes is all it takes. This is encouraging because many busy people don't have time to exercise.

In addition to the brain benefits, this type of exercise also has many benefits for overall health. As previous research has found, HIIT workouts improve cardiovascular health and reduce the risk of future health problems.
